Last month Restructuring Perspectives highlighted crucial issues at the intersection of privacy and distress presented by the Chapter 11 case of 23andMe. Specifically, “Data for Sale” discussed the recent appointment of a “Consumer Privacy Ombudsman” (CPO) charged with assisting the Court in its consideration of the facts, circumstances, and conditions of the company’s proposed sale of personal consumer data.
